Comeng (train) - in Popular Culture

In Popular Culture

In the video clip "All Torn Down" by Melbourne band "The Living End", the band is seen boarding an unrefurbished Comeng.

The unrefurbished Comeng also appears on the front cover of a Melbourne Hip Hop artist Fubex, his album was "Upcoming". It also features the now defunct Harris Motor.

Portions of the unrefurbished Comeng can be in scenes of a 1990 film called "The Big Steal" directed by Nadia Tass.
